Power for Best Rated Hunting Binoculars

The model number on the binocular will tell you its magnification power. For example, 8×42 has a magnification power of 8x, and 10*42 binocular has 10x magnification. Now, don’t be confused by the term magnification power. It refers to “Enlarging the apparent size of something.” In 8x magnification, you’ll see your target eight times larger than the naked eye, and in 10x magnification, ten times larger object.
It depends on the type of game you’re going to play. Generally speaking, the magnification power of 8x to 10x is sufficient for all kinds of hunting games because the higher the magnification power, the lower the will be image steadiness.
Objective Lens Diameter
Another essential point in binocular features is its objective lens diameter. The model number on the binoculars will also tell you its objective lens. For example, 10×42 means that the lens size is 42mm. The greater the lens length, the more will be details of the object. However, the price of binoculars will proportionally increase as the size of the lens increases. For example, a binocular with a 52mm lens will cost more than 42mm.

You need a bigger objective lens in low-light hunting or hunting at night. But binoculars with bigger size lenses have some drawbacks. They are challenging to carry on the long hunt as they are bulky. Binoculars having a less than 42mm objective lens are considered the best compact pair of hunting binoculars with a good performance by most consumers.

Anti-Reflective Lens Coating
The most irritating thing you might feel during your enjoyable event is color reflection. If the colors reflect on your lens, you will miss your target. The best pair of binoculars come with different levels of anti-reflection lens coating.
- Coated: Single layer of anti-reflection coating, which reduces light loss to give a better image.
- Multi-Coated: Multiple anti-reflection coating layers on your lens that result in less color reflection to enhance the image quality
- Fully-Coated: The glass surface of the objective is anti-reflective.
- Fully multi-coated: The entire glass surface of the objective have multiple anti-reflective layers.
Wide Field of View
A field of view shows how wider the picture can be seen from a specific range using binoculars this range measures in feet over 1000 yards. The greater the field of view, the Wider will be the picture of the object. They have a slightly wider field of view, making them the best binoculars for long-distance distances.
The magnification slightly reduces as the field of view becomes wide. If you target a moving object or play hunt in an open area where you can compromise magnification, the broad field of view will be perfect.

Twilight Factor
How will you know the efficiency of binoculars in low light? The twilight factor tells you about this. But how?
It is very simple. You just have to multiply the magnification power of your binos with the size of the lens and take the square root of your answer. The more significant the result (Twilight Factor), the more efficient is your binoculars in low light. Generally, the Twilight factor of 17 or more works perfectly in low light.
Binocular Eye Relief
Binoculars eye relief is the distance you can hold your binoculars from your eye if you don’t wear glasses or even sunglasses while hunting, then no need to be concerned about eye relief.
But if you wear glasses during the hunt, the distance from your eye to binoculars becomes less, and you wouldn’t be able to see the complete picture. Therefore, those who wear glasses should go for at least 14mm eye relief to see the entire image.

Guidelines to Opt ideal binoculars
- Magnification higher than 10x is too sensitive for bare hands, which eventually doesn’t make a good binocular. The optimal range of magnificent is 6x-10x. However, good binoculars can be kept up to 12x. Otherwise, the image would be unclear and too shaky.
- Wide-angle binoculars are very handy to locate an object from a long distance.
- In the case of eyeglass wearers, binoculars with a focal point of 15mm or longer behind the lens are recommended.
- Water Resistant binoculars with lens glass that doesn’t adhere to water droplets are ideal as they would give a clear image in case of water sprays.
